Introduction
“Building a StoryBrand” by Donald Miller is a groundbreaking marketing guide that revolutionizes how businesses communicate with their customers. Published in 2017, this book introduces the StoryBrand framework, a powerful tool designed to help companies clarify their message and connect more effectively with their audience. Miller, a bestselling author and marketing expert, draws on the universal appeal of storytelling to create a practical, easy-to-implement system for crafting compelling brand narratives.
Summary of Key Points
The StoryBrand Framework
- Miller introduces the SB7 Framework, a seven-part storytelling structure based on classic narrative elements
- The framework positions the customer as the hero and the brand as the guide
- This structure helps businesses create a clear, compelling message that resonates with their audience
Understanding Your Customer’s Story
- Businesses must identify their customer’s internal and external problems
- The goal is to create empathy and show understanding of the customer’s struggles
- By addressing these problems, brands can position themselves as the solution
Clarifying Your Message
- Miller emphasizes the importance of simplicity and clarity in brand messaging
- He introduces the concept of the “one-liner” - a concise statement that summarizes what a business offers
- Clear messaging helps customers quickly understand how a brand can help them
The Power of Story in Marketing
- Stories are a fundamental way humans process information and make decisions
- By framing marketing messages as stories, brands can make their offerings more memorable and engaging
- The book outlines how to use storytelling techniques in various marketing materials
Creating a BrandScript
- The BrandScript is a practical tool for implementing the StoryBrand framework
- It helps businesses organize their messaging and ensure consistency across all platforms
- Miller provides step-by-step instructions for creating an effective BrandScript
Implementing StoryBrand Across Your Business
- The book covers how to apply the StoryBrand principles to various aspects of a business:
- Website design
- Email marketing
- Sales funnels
- Social media strategy
- Miller provides practical examples and case studies to illustrate these applications
The StoryBrand Marketing Roadmap
- A five-step plan for implementing the StoryBrand framework in any business
- Includes creating lead generators, nurture campaigns, and sales conversion strategies
- Emphasizes the importance of continual refinement and testing of marketing messages

Critical Analysis
Strengths
Practical and Actionable: One of the most significant strengths of “Building a StoryBrand” is its practicality. Miller doesn’t just present theories; he provides a clear, step-by-step framework that businesses can immediately implement. The BrandScript tool, in particular, offers a tangible way to apply the book’s principles.
Universal Applicability: The StoryBrand framework is versatile enough to be applied to businesses of all sizes and across various industries. This universality makes the book valuable for a wide range of readers, from small business owners to marketing professionals in large corporations.
Focus on Clarity: In a world where marketing messages often become convoluted, Miller’s emphasis on clarity and simplicity is refreshing and effective. The book convincingly argues that clear, concise messaging is more powerful than clever or complex marketing strategies.
Customer-Centric Approach: By positioning the customer as the hero of the brand story, Miller shifts the focus from self-promotion to customer empowerment. This approach aligns well with modern marketing trends that prioritize customer experience and value.
Integration of Storytelling: The book effectively demonstrates how storytelling can be a powerful tool in marketing. By tapping into the universal appeal of narrative structures, Miller provides a fresh perspective on crafting marketing messages.
Weaknesses
Oversimplification: While the simplicity of the StoryBrand framework is generally a strength, it may oversimplify complex marketing challenges for some businesses. Critics argue that not all brands or products can be easily fit into this narrative structure.
Limited Focus on Data: The book places heavy emphasis on storytelling and messaging but provides relatively little guidance on data-driven marketing strategies. In today’s digital age, this omission may be seen as a limitation by some readers.
Potential for Formulaic Approach: There’s a risk that strict adherence to the StoryBrand framework could lead to formulaic marketing messages. Businesses may need to be cautious about losing their unique voice or differentiating factors in the process of implementing the framework.
Lack of Depth in Some Areas: While the book covers a wide range of topics, some readers might find that certain areas, such as social media strategy or email marketing, are not explored in sufficient depth.

Controversies and Debates
While the book has been widely praised, it has also sparked some debates in the marketing community:
Originality of Concepts: Some critics argue that Miller’s framework draws heavily from existing narrative theories and marketing concepts without offering truly groundbreaking ideas.
Effectiveness Across All Industries: There’s ongoing discussion about whether the StoryBrand approach is equally effective across all types of businesses and industries.
Balance Between Storytelling and Data: In the age of data-driven marketing, there’s debate about finding the right balance between narrative-based approaches like StoryBrand and more analytical marketing strategies.
